About this game

What this game is, in the developer's words

Physics Cake is a 2-D physics simulation game where you can draw containers, objects, or anything you want really and put whatever chosen physical object you want inside of it.

Physics Cake is a 2-D physics simulation game where you can draw containers, objects, or anything you want really and put whatever chosen physical object you want inside of it. All the objects have different interactions that are designed to be fun and entertaining.

Physics Cake is similar to old “sand-like” games you would find online many years ago.

Physics Cake is designed to be fun and entertaining, like paint, but with basic physics.

You can also save your creations and simulations. You can easily share your simulations with anyone else by sharing your saved text files with them. Physics Cake supports steam cloud, so anything you have saved will be backed up to steam automatically when you exit the game. This way you can keep your creations across devices.

The game is easy to start and has built-in help descriptions for all the objects and basic functions by clicking the ? Or ?2 buttons in the game.

Physics Cake is always open to add user suggestions so if you pick up a copy please feel free to create a discussion thread with your input. Our general goal was to make a fun open 2-D simulation game that can be entertaining for minutes or for hours. Physics cake has had multiple content updates since its release and we plan to come back to it occasionally and add even more content. Physics cake is also steam deck compatible with steam inputs. 

Below is a list of all the objects currently in the game (objects are able to be re-arranged after spawning by right-clicking and dragging the object as wanted):

None: nothing spawned on click (default)

Delete: A red crossed through circle that deletes anything you touch with it.

Line: A solid line to draw things with, or make containers.

Water: A liquid ball of water.

Oil: A liquid glob of oil.

Steam: Quick rising steam that evaporates.

Fire: It burns things, duh!

Wood: Woodblocks that act similarly to the line (wood can be affected by other objects life fire).

Jello: Wiggly, jiggly jelly, bouncy, and expandable.

Spinner-R: Spins to the right like a singular fan blade.

Spinner-L: Spins to the left like a singular fan blade

Void: A tiny black hole, anything sucked into it is deleted automatically.

Clack: Clacker balls that are pinned to the spawn area

Grass: Grass, can be watered to be grown.

Ice: Cubes of ice that freeze things and jiggle like real ice cubes.

Water-SP: Endlessly spawns water objects from the chosen location.

Ice-SP: Endlessly spawns ice objects from the chosen location.

Oil-SP: Endlessly spawns oil objects from the chosen location.

Jello-SP: Endlessly spawns jello objects from the chosen location.

Steam-SP: Endlessly spawns steam objects from the chosen location.

E-SP: Endlessly spawns electron objects.

Sand-SP: Endlessly spawns sand objects.

Kill Line: The standard object, but any physical objects that touch it are removed on contact.

Pulley: Two connected weights that make up a pulley system.

Sticky: Sticks to other physical objects. (limited to 400 instances on screen at once)

COLORED L BUTTONS: Produces the LINE object in the chosen color.

Etron: Short for electron. Bounces randomly at high velocity. Not affected by void, wood, or ice, and can electrify objects on contact.

Drag u: Drags any physical objects upwards that are below it.

Fire-SP: Endlessly spawns fire objects above it.

Kill Line: The standard object, but any physical objects that touch it are removed on contact.

Ball: The clacker ball object, but unpinned so it can move around freely.

Stick: A little stick figure man (limit one). Try not to set him on fire… You monster…

Sand: It’s EVERYWHERE

Portal In: Anything that goes in the in portal will come out of the out portal. (limit 1)

Portal Out: Things that go in the in portal will come out of this one. (limit 1)

Marshmallow: A squishy marshmallow line object.

Ethanol: Liquid ethanol, burns easily. 

Oxygen: Oxygen in gas form. Bounces around the room and rises to the top. 

Hydrogen: Hydrogen in gas form. Bounces around the room and rises to the top. Highly combustible.

Rock: That's not a boulder, it's a rock, a big heavy rock. 

Chlorine: Chlorine gas. Rises to the top of the room.

Sodium: Sodium plus water goes boom. Sodium interacts with a bunch of things. 

Uranium: Uranium is radioactive and will give off radioactive particles.

Chlorine-SP: Endlessly spawns chlorine objects from the chosen location. 

Hydrogen-SP: Endlessly spawns hydrogen objects from the chosen location.

Oxygen-SP: Endlessly spawns hydrogen objects from the chosen location. 

Ethanol-SP: Endlessly spans ethanol objects from the chosen location. 

Ash: Crumbly dark ash.

Gold: Gold bars, use them to crush things. 

Lava: Molten hot lava that burns stuff.

Blob: Anything that touches the blob becomes the blob.

Cake: A slice of cake. It's not a lie!

Nanite: Warping self replicating nanomachines. Limit of 400 per sandboxes. Nanomachines son!

There are also a bunch of hidden objects you can only get through combining things!

You can also alter the gravity of the simulation at any time you wish.
